Desktop
- Use W A S D or arrow keys to move the camera if supported.
- Left click with the mouse to select pets, tools, and UI buttons.
- Drag tools from the toolbar onto the patient to apply treatment.
- Press number keys (1-5) to quickly switch tools if shortcuts are available.
Mobile
- Tap objects and pets to interact.
- Drag tools onto the pet to use them.
- Pinch to zoom the camera if available.
- Use on-screen buttons to switch tools and access menus.

Pet Doctor Business Tycoon is a family friendly animal hospital simulator that puts you in charge of caring for cats, dogs, rabbits, and more. Your goal is to diagnose illnesses, treat injuries, and restore each pet to full health while growing a successful clinic. The game balances medical tasks with business choices so you plan treatments, manage time, and upgrade equipment.
Gameplay mixes hands on care and mini games. Use diagnostic tools to check heartbeats, clean wounds, apply medicines, and perform simple surgeries. Each patient arrives with unique symptoms and a short treatment plan. Complete jobs quickly to earn coins, unlock new tools, and expand or decorate your clinic. Bright 3D graphics, smooth animations, and accessible controls make this title easy to pick up for players of all ages.
- Diagnose pets using visual clues and tool interactions.
- Perform treatments such as wound cleaning, medicine dosing, and basic surgeries.
- Manage patient queues and time to keep the clinic efficient and profitable.
- Customize rooms, buy advanced tools, and unlock new animal types as you progress.
The game appeals to casual players who enjoy simulation, animal care, and light time management. It teaches simple medical steps while offering progression rewards and cosmetic upgrades to keep play fresh.
